This product has not been tested for freeze-thaw stability. However, in powder form, repeatedly removing this product from a freezer for the purpose of preparing fresh solutions, is not expected to be detrimental to the protein. Prepared solutions may be stored up to 1 week at 2 - 8 °C. It is not recommended to freeze stock solutions, as the freeze-thaw process may lead to protein degradation.

F4883-500MG contains Sodium Citrate and Sodium Chlorure. Is it possible to have their concentration ? What is the volume of sodium chloride we have to put in the bottle please?
1 answer-
This material is lyophilized from a solution of 75 mM NaCl (4.39 mg/mL), 10 mM Na Citrate (2.94 mg/mL). It can be solubilized in 0.85% (w/v) sodium chloride to 2 mg/ml, by layering the protein on top of the saline solution and placing it in a 37°C water bath for 4-6 hours, with gentle agitation.

Hello. For your F4883-500MG Fibrinogen product, is there 500mg of pure fibrinogen in the vial? Or is there 500 mg of reagent - of which a fraction is clottable Fibrinogen? Do you have preparation instructions for this reagent?
1 answer-
F4883-500MG contains 500 mg of solid. Fibrinogen can be solubilized in 0.85% (w/v) sodium chloride (2 mg/ml) by layering the protein on top of the saline solution and placing it in a 37 °C water bath for 4-6 hours with gentle agitation.
